“When Carole Bruno was well on her way to publishing her first book, Nathan: Love, Remembrance, and a Grandmother’s Journey Through Grief, she joined my memoir-writing class with a stack of handwritten papers and yellow pads piled in front of her. Taking copious notes from the lecture and always the willing participant in sharing her work with the class, Carole had me convinced that my learned advice was landing well and would display elegantly in her work. But Carole follows a unique path carved of steadfast spirituality, unassailable determination, and grit that led her to produce a masterpiece of devotion in a tribute to her beloved grandson—bucking my profound counsel all the way. She was right to do so, as she turns grief into a purposeful expression of celebration as only she can. Chatter from My Heart: Whispers From Heaven is her second book. As with Nathan, a portion of the proceeds will go to organizations supporting grief-torn families everywhere. Carole and husband, Ed, split their time between Rhode Island and the deserts of the Southwest.” —Danna Weber, MA English
